Golf Course Layouts and Golf Modeling
Modern golf course architects leverage advanced Golf Modeling techniques to sculpt the land and refine their Golf Course Layouts with unparalleled precision, ensuring optimal flow.
- Strategic Feature Placement: Every bunker, water hazard, and tree in the Golf Course Layouts is strategically placed through Golf Modeling to influence shot selection, create visual appeal, and challenge golfers of all skill levels.
- Drainage and Water Flow Simulation: Critical for playability and sustainability, Golf Modeling can simulate water flow across the Golf Course Layouts, identifying areas prone to pooling and allowing designers to incorporate effective drainage solutions from the outset.
- Environmental Integration: Golf Modeling assists in integrating the course seamlessly with existing environmental features, minimizing disruption to natural habitats and maximizing the aesthetic appeal of the Golf Course Layouts.
- Cut-and-Fill Optimization: For large earthmoving projects, Golf Modeling tools help optimize cut-and-fill operations, minimizing the movement of soil, which reduces construction costs and environmental impact, directly influencing the feasibility of the proposed Golf Course Layouts.
Visualizing the Journey: 3D Golf Course Model
Once the design concepts are established through Golf Modeling, they are brought to life through a comprehensive 3D Golf Course Model and the overall Golf Course 3D, allowing for full visualization of the player’s journey.
- Immersive Flyovers: A 3D Golf Course Model enables virtual flyovers of the entire course, providing a bird’s-eye view of the Golf Course Layouts, showcasing the transitions between holes and the overall flow of play.
- Sunlight Studies: A Golf Course 3D model can simulate sunlight at different times of day and year, identifying areas of harsh glare, persistent shadows, or optimal light for tee shots and greens, influencing the final Golf Course Layouts.
- Vegetation Placement: The 3D Golf Course Model allows for the precise placement of digital trees and shrubbery, ensuring they contribute to the beauty and strategic challenge of the Golf Course Layouts without impeding play or views.
- Virtual Playtesting: In advanced stages, a 3D Golf Course Model can be integrated into a simulator for virtual playtesting, allowing designers to experience the flow themselves and gather feedback on the playability of the Golf Course Layouts.
Golf Course Mapping and Custom Golf Course Map
The journey continues with precise Golf Course Mapping, which translates the intricate Golf Course Layouts into practical navigation tools for the golfer.
- Accurate Yardage Books: Golf Course Mapping forms the basis for highly accurate digital and physical yardage books, providing precise distances to hazards, green fronts, and pin positions, helping players strategize their shots and manage their game flow.
- GPS Integration for On-Course Navigation: Mobile apps and on-cart GPS systems utilize Golf Course Mapping to provide real-time location tracking, showing the golfer’s position on a Custom Golf Course Map.
- Hole-by-Hole Strategy Overviews: The Custom Golf Course Map can include detailed strategic advice for each hole, derived from the Golf Course Layouts, suggesting optimal lines off the tee or preferred approach angles, guiding the player’s decision-making.
- Pin Placement and Golf Green Map: The Golf Course Mapping extends to the greens themselves, allowing for precise pin placement data to be uploaded daily, which then feeds into a detailed Golf Green Map for putting strategy.
